Foros del Web » Soporte técnico » Ofimática »

Buscarv

Estas en el tema de Buscarv en el foro de Ofimática en Foros del Web. estoy realizando un buscarv pero en la matriz que estoy buscando. el valor a buscar tiene mas de una fila, ya que no es unica. ...
  #1 (permalink)  
Antiguo 09/01/2009, 08:20
Avatar de aRTeX  
Fecha de Ingreso: mayo-2005
Mensajes: 374
Antigüedad: 18 años, 11 meses
Puntos: 0
Buscarv

estoy realizando un buscarv pero en la matriz que estoy buscando. el valor a buscar tiene mas de una fila, ya que no es unica.


como puedo hacer para poder realizar un buscarv y que me extraiga todos los datos asociados a ese dato.

o sea que el buscarv avance y no siempre me traiga el mismo dato.

espero que hayan entendido y me puedan ayudar.

gracias.
  #2 (permalink)  
Antiguo 15/01/2009, 16:14
Avatar de abrahamvj  
Fecha de Ingreso: julio-2006
Ubicación: Lima, Peru
Mensajes: 708
Antigüedad: 17 años, 9 meses
Puntos: 18
Respuesta: Buscarv

Suponiendo los datos a buscar en A2:A10, los datos buscados en B2:B10 y el dato a buscar en D2, y en E2 hacia abajo, estaran los diferentes resultados de la busqueda, entonces, en E2:

=SI(FILAS(E$2:E2)<=CONTAR.SI(A$2:A$10,D$2),INDICE( B$2:B$10,K.ESIMO.MENOR(SI(A$2:A$10=D$2,FILA(A$2:A$ 10)-FILA(A$2)+1),FILAS(E$2:E2))),"")


Lugeo "jalar" hacia abajo :)

OJO, es matricial, hay que ingresarla con CTRL+SHIFT+ENTER

Abraham
  #3 (permalink)  
Antiguo 18/01/2009, 08:15
 
Fecha de Ingreso: julio-2008
Mensajes: 99
Antigüedad: 15 años, 8 meses
Puntos: 1
Respuesta: Buscarv

Hola,

abrahamvj,

Que formula tan util haz puesto en este post.

Gracias, no te imaginas cuanto me servirá.
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 11:12.